Sib. 7.0: tenor voice playback
Posted by Carolina - 15 Feb 06:21PM
I have written a piece in SSATBB but the Tenor voice plays back as Bass and the notes which are absolutely in the T range are mostly red onscreen. Any suggestions? I'm a fairly newbie. Thanks.

Re: Sib. 7.0: tenor voice playback
Posted by Robin Walker - 15 Feb 06:26PM
Please attach the score which demonstrates the issue, as we cannot otherwise work out how you have the Tenor voice configured.

Please remember that the Tenor voice instrument incorporates an octave-down transposition: it sounds an octave lower than written.

Re: Sib. 7.0: tenor voice playback
Posted by Jeff Hale - 15 Feb 07:41PM
The tenor, as an instrument, is set to playback down an octave, as it is generally written that way. See the attached.

Re: Sib. 7.0: tenor voice playback
Posted by Adrian Drover - 16 Feb 12:10AM
But if Carolina wants the part in bass clef, transposition needs to be edited to actual pitch (middle C = C4). As attached.
